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 1,840 people in 457 households, with 975 male residents and 865 female residents. The average household size is 4.03, and SC share is 9.13% and ST share is 13.04% for Goragi. Population density works out to about 530.29 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Goragi show that reported agricultural commodities include Dhan, Soyabean and Wheat, net sown area is 258.67 hectares and irrigated land is 139.1 hectares (53.8%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
